    What Is a Corner Rounding Machine and Why Does Radius Precision Matter?

    A corner rounding machine uses a hardened die — precision-ground to a defined radius — to remove the right-angle corner of a stacked sheet or bound book cover in a single hydraulic stroke. The resulting curved corner is not merely cosmetic: it reduces page wear, eliminates sharp-edge injury risk, and satisfies the radius tolerances specified by major retail and institutional buyers.

    Radius precision matters because a deviation of as little as 1.5 mm from a specified R10 profile is visible to the naked eye when comparing adjacent products on a shelf. For OEM manufacturers supplying branded stationery or corporate book programmes, this deviation can trigger a whole-batch rejection.

    Frame Mass: The Most Overlooked Specification

    Buyers sourcing corner rounders often focus exclusively on radius options and sheet capacity. Frame mass — the structural weight of the machine — is rarely featured in marketing literature, yet it is arguably the most consequential specification for sustained production quality.

    When a die strikes a 4 mm grey-board stack, it generates a reactive force that propagates through the frame. In a lightweight (sub-80 kg) machine, this force causes micro-flex in the frame, which shifts the die position by fractions of a millimetre relative to the cutting bed. Across thousands of cycles, this produces radius creep — the gradual deviation of output corners from the nominal specification.

    The KY-425’s 130 kg cast-iron frame eliminates this mechanism. The frame’s inertia is sufficient to absorb cutting shock without measurable deflection, maintaining consistent die-to-bed geometry across the full production run.

    Single-Phase vs. Three-Phase Power: A Real Installation Cost Consideration

    Many industrial machines in the 1 kW+ range require three-phase power. For facilities without existing three-phase distribution infrastructure, adding a three-phase panel typically costs $800–2,500 USD in North America, plus the associated permit and inspection timeline of 2–6 weeks.

    The KY-425 operates on 220 V single-phase, a standard supply available in virtually every industrial unit. This eliminates panel upgrade costs entirely and means the machine can be operational within hours of installation — a relevant factor for buyers operating on tight production launch schedules.

    Mold Interchangeability: One Machine, Multiple Radius Specifications

    The most commercially flexible corner rounding configuration is a single machine platform with a validated family of interchangeable mold sets. The KY-425’s quick-swap mold system enables operators to change between R6, R8, R10, and R12 dies in under five minutes without specialist tools.

    • R6 — used for small-format notebooks and compact stationery items where a tight radius matches the product’s aesthetic language
    • R8 — common for mid-format paperback covers, educational workbooks, and branded corporate stationery
    • R10 — the industry standard for premium hardcover books, A4 catalogues, and retail-ready packaging
    • R12 — specified for children’s board books and heavy-gauge rigid packaging requiring a pronounced safe-edge profile

    Purchasing a single KY-425 with a full mold set eliminates the capital and floor-space cost of maintaining separate machines for each radius specification — a common inefficiency in facilities that grew their radius range incrementally.
